Independent Practice at RCOT
Independent practice is a growing part of occupational therapy practice in the UK.
It includes all work outside statutory services across private practice and third sectors, and encompasses a variety of roles including practice owners, associates and employment. Additionally, it is very common for occupational therapists to work across sectors and roles via portfolio careers. Many occupational therapists use portfolio working to build flexible, sustainable careers.

What is independent practice?
Independent practice includes all work carried out outside statutory services. This may include employed and self-employed roles in both private and third sectors. It is not a specialism. Independent practitioners work across all areas of occupational therapy.
How is independent practice related to portfolio careers?
A portfolio career combines different roles and income streams. Many occupational therapists use portfolio working to build flexible, sustainable careers that combine different types of employment across a variety of sectors including statutory services, higher education, or independent work.
